Jamie Green second on the grid at the Nürburgring.

Jamie Green (AMG Mercedes C-Class) was the fastest-qualifying Mercedes-Benz driver, and will start Sunday’s sixth race of the 2011 DTM season at the Nürburgring (start: 14:00, live on ARD from 13:45) in second place on the grid. At the end of the qualifying session, the Brit scored an individual lap time of 1:35.246 minutes.

Carlsson Lifttronic® technology lifts the car over obstacles.

Sporty yet fit for everyday use: With the Carlsson Lifttronic®, the Mercedes-Benz SLS AMG and its open roadster version can be raised by 40 millimetres at both axles at the push of a button, allowing the supercar to easily get over underground car park exits, speed bumps or rough level crossings without damaging the front apron or the car’s underbody.

24h Race Spa: Podium for Black Falcon

Black Falcon was the best of the four Mercedes-AMG customer teams with the near-production SLS AMG GT3 in the 24h race at Spa-Francorchamps, Belgium. After the race twice around the clock, Kenneth Heyer/Thomas Jäger/Stéphane Lémeret finished third, 10 laps behind the winners. After a total race distance of 545 laps and 3,817 kilometres, this is a gap of only 70 kilometres. British twins David and Godfrey Jones, both 58 years old, also underlined the excellent performance of the gullwing car, improving by 19 positions against strong competition and coming home seventh together with their “junior” partner Mike Jordan, 53.

SLS AMG GT3 – 24 hours race of Spa-Francorchamps.

On 30 July 2011 the customer team Black Falcon will be at the starting line of the 24-hour race in Spa-Francorchamps (Belgium) with the Mercedes-Benz SLS AMG GT3. The gull-wing with start number 35 has been given the same look as the Mercedes-Benz 300 SEL 6.8 AMG with which Hans Heyer and Clemens Schickentanz achieved a class victory and overall second place 40 years ago. Among the drivers of the SLS AMG GT3 will be Kenneth Heyer, Hans Heyer’s son. A total of seven gull-wings will compete in this classic Belgian long-distance race.

The new Mercedes-Benz C 63 AMG Coupé Black Series:

The most powerful C-Class of all time.

Spectacular design, technology transfer from the world of motorsport and driving dynamics at the highest level; the new Mercedes-Benz C 63 AMG Coupé Black Series embodies the new AMG brand claim, Driving Performance, like no other AMG model.
